Cassiodorus in Psalmos, pars iii — Lanthony (secunda), Gloucestershire. Augustinian priory of St Mary the Virgin and St John the Baptist.
Provenance: | Lanthony (secunda), Gloucestershire. Augustinian priory of St Mary the Virgin and St John the Baptist. |
Location: | Lambeth Palace Library, London |
Shelfmark: | 29 |
Author/Title: | Cassiodorus in Psalmos, pars iii |
Type of evidence: | m: evidence from marginalia, sometimes distinctive of a particular house or known scribe |

Notes on evidence: | The pencil numbering of Psalms at the foot of pages suggests Lanthony. For Lambet Palace 29 and other entries marked with the siglum m, see N. R. Ker, in E. G. W. Bill, A Catalogue of Manuscripts in Lambeth Palace Library, MSS. 1222–1860 (Oxford 1972), p. 11 n. 1. |
Date: | s. xiii |
Medieval Catalogue: | A16.54 Further details of medieval catalogue: A16. AUGUSTINIAN CANONS: Lanthony: Catalogue, late 14th cent. |
